HCG is a hormone that makes your LP last longer.

Many times, they treat LPD with clomid, trying to fix the cycle from the "front end" as my RE put it. She said that most people who have a short LP are not ovulating properly. The clomid wasn't enough to support my LP so I do supplemental hcg.

My advice-- get to a fertility specialist. Call your ob and ask for a referral if you need one. A regular ob isn't going to have the specialization that an RE/fertility doctor will.
